Xbox One ‘Exclusivity’ Titanfall Was Crucial; Dev Wants To Reach As Many Possible With Titanfall 2

Respawn Entertainment founder Vince Zampella on the necessity of Titanfall as console exclusive for the Xbox One. Zampella adds that a lot will be fixed with the release of Titanfall 2 and that he and his team wants as much players possible to enjoy their games.
